Background: Nocardia asteroides complex is aerobic actinomycete, partially acid-fast and Gram –positive which rarely cause ocular infections especially in immunodeficient persons. Case Presentation: An 83-year-old man with diabetes presented with nasolacrimal duct obstruction to Labbafinejad Hospital Tehran –Iran. According to the clinical examination and microbial assessment cause of illness was diagnosed as Nocardia asteroides complex. Conclusion: Diagnosis of Nocardia asteroides complex as a cause of nasolacrimal duct infection for prompt and proper treatment is effective.
